Disney’s ‘Falcon and the Winter Soldier’ spin-off series might welcome two ‘Civil War’ characters 

Looks like we will be seeing two MCU characters heading to the Falcon and the Winter Soldier spin-off on Disney’s upcoming streaming service. Announced last year, Disney+ will be getting releasing this six-part series with MCU actors Anthony Mackie and Sebastian Stan reprising their roles as Falcon and the Winter Soldier, respectively. And it looks like they might be joined by two characters from Captain America: Civil WarIt’s being reported that Emily VanCamp and Daniel Bruhl will be reprising their roles as Peggy Carter’s niece Sharon and villain Zemo, respectively. Now, we’re going to keep our eyes peeled for any updates in the casting or the show itself. Directed by Kari Skogland and produced by Marvel Studios and Kevin Feige, the Falcon and the Winter Soldier is tipped to premiere in August 2020.

‘Avengers: Endgame’ gets ‘Spider-Man: Far From Home’ trailer as its post-credits scene

Jay Maidment/Sony Pictures

If you were waiting for a “proper” post-credits scene for Avengers: Endgame and was disappointed, then here’s some news for you. The epic finale to the Infinity Saga finally gets a post-credits scene. Now, if you’re a fan, you’ve probably already seen it, though. Endgame’s new post-credits scene is the second trailer for Spider-Man: Far From Home. And if you’ve seen it, you know it’s full of spoilers and Easter eggs about Endgame, so it seems like a proper thing to tack onto the end of the film. So, if you’re catching Endgame for the first time or heading into theatres for the nth time, then now you know you can stay to the end for a post-credits scene.

The latest promo for ‘Avengers: Endgame’ is a harsh reminder of who we lost

Courtesy of MCU_Direct/Twitter

With Avengers: Endgame just a month away from coming out and Marvel is reminding us of the heroes we’ve lost in Infinity War. Each actor who had an Instagram or Twitter account posted their character posters with the words “Avenge the Fallen” written over their faces. All posts also had the caption “1 Month. #AvengersEndgame” which refers to the worldwide premiere happening on April 26th. One clever thing Marvel did was colour the posters of the MCU heroes we assume are still alive while leaving those in grey we thought we’ve lost already (Hey! We’re still not losing hope.)
